Add ANativeWindow API for directly drawing to the surface bits.

Also other cleanup and fixes:

- We now properly set the default window format to 565.
- New APIs to set the window format and flags from native code.
- Tweaked glue for simpler handling of the "destroy" message.
- Um, other stuff.
